Handling CD Media

Take care when handling blank CD-R and CD-RW media. Dust, scratches, and fingerprints
on either side of the disc can cause write errors during recording. When picking up or
holding blank media you can either place your fingers along the outer edge of the disc, or
place one finger through the center hole and one finger on the outer edge. Once you have
finished creating a disc, label it by writing on the top using permanent ink.
CAUTION: We recommend using a "non-toxic" marker, such as a Sharpie pen that
conforms to the ASTM D-4236 standard. Some permanent markers will damage the media.
Also, do not press too hard when writing on the disc.
CAUTION: We do not recommend placing self-sticking CD-R labels on the disc. The weight
of the label may unbalance the disc and cause write errors during recording or read errors
during reading. Moreover, removing the label later may damage the disc permanently.

Cleaning Discs

For proper read and write performance, your CD-R, CD-RW, and CD-ROM discs must be
clean. Trying to record on a dirty disc may result in a failed session and ruin the disc.
To clean the disc, wipe the disc using a clean, soft cotton cloth to remove surface dirt such
as fingerprints. Use a straight-line motion, wiping from the center out. Do not wipe the disc
in a circular motion.
Figure 6: Wipe the Disc from the Center Outward
HINT: Keep your frequently used discs in jewel cases at all times to prevent them from
becoming dirty or damaged.
